B. Solve these word problems.
1. Andrew had 2/3 dozen eggs. He used 1/6 dozen eggs to bake a cake.
What fraction of a dozen was he left with?​

Step-by-step explanation:

Total dozen of eggs = 2/3

Used to bake cake = 1/6

remaining dozen of eggs = 2/3 - 1/6

= (4 - 1)/6

= 3/6 or 1/2

Hence, he is left with 3/6 or 1/2 dozen of eggs
